  7. You did a great job, and I hope you've continued with the crochet kick. I've always got a project or two going on, but to me the easiest and fastest things to crochet are dish rags, or wash cloths. (You want to use cotton yarn, like "Sugar and Cream" brand). I use them in my kitchen instead of sponges.
    I'll tell you one thing I learned long ago that really made crocheting much, much easier for me. It's this: the loop on your hook is NOT a stitch. So if your pattern says, for example, 'single crochet in second chain from hook' you count from the first chain past the hook and go from there. It helped me to not have wonky messes, LOL!
